Patent number: 10402914Abstract: Mechanisms are provided for determining contact-related information items for presentation to a user, such that the user can refer to the information items to enhance the user's communication with the contact. Contact-related information items that have a high relevance level may be accessed and presented to the user. In a case in which no or limited high relevance level information items exist, contact-related information items associated with incrementally lower levels of relevance may be accessed and presented. Moreover, according to some example embodiments, relevance may be derived based on the relationship of the user with the particular contact and/or the frequency of communications with the contact.Type: GrantFiled: February 22, 2013Date of Patent: September 3, 2019Assignee: Nokia Technologies OyInventors: Don Yamato Kuramura, Bryan Thomas Biniak, Peter Matthew Mauro, Roope Rainisto

Patent number: 9473893Abstract: An approach is provided for an application engine (e.g., a gaming engine) based on real-time location-based data. In one embodiment, an application engine determines one or more location-based data sources associated with at least one device. The one or more location-based data sources are determined in at least substantially real-time while the at least one device is engaged in at least one travel activity. The application engine then determines one or more elements of an application engine based, at least in part, on the one or more location-based data sources. The application engine causes, at least in part, a presentation of the one or more elements at the least one device during the at least one travel activity. In one embodiment, the application engine also causes, at least in part, a transformation of the one or more map data elements based, at least in part, on the one or more location-based data sources.Type: GrantFiled: August 7, 2015Date of Patent: October 18, 2016Assignee: Nokia Technologies OyInventors: Don Yamato Kuramura, Bryan Thomas Biniak

Publication number: 20140244737Abstract: Methods, apparatuses, and computer program products are herein provided for providing trivia during a communication session. A method may include determining at least one trivia candidate for a communication session between at least two users. The at least one trivia candidate comprises factual information relevant to a context of the communication session. The method may further include causing the at least one trivia candidate to be proposed to at least one of the users. Corresponding apparatuses and computer program products are also provided.Type: ApplicationFiled: February 22, 2013Publication date: August 28, 2014Applicant: NOKIA CORPORATIONInventors: Bryan Thomas Biniak, Don Yamato Kuramura

Publication number: 20140245157Abstract: An approach is provided for processing and presenting aggregated information to a user via an augmented reality user interface. A processing platform processes and/or facilitates a processing of location information or contextual information associated with at least one user to determine one or more parameters for causing an aggregation of information across a plurality of data sources. Further, the processing platform causes an initiation of the aggregation of the information based on the one or more parameters. Additionally, the processing platform causes a presentation of the aggregation of the information in an augmented reality user interface, wherein the aggregation of the information includes, at least in part, location-based content.Type: ApplicationFiled: February 22, 2013Publication date: August 28, 2014Applicant: NOKIA CORPORATIONInventors: Bryan Thomas Biniak, Don Yamato Kuramura
